What is the Iowa Residential Lease Agreement?

The Iowa Residential Lease Agreement is a vital legal document used in real estate transactions to establish the rental terms between a landlord and tenant in Iowa. This agreement outlines the essential aspects of the rental relationship, including responsibilities, rental rates, and legal obligations of both parties. It is crucial that both the landlord and tenant sign this lease for it to hold legal significance.
This form acts as a safeguard, ensuring clarity in the agreement and reducing potential disputes related to terms and conditions. The necessity of signing the Iowa rental agreement form reinforces the commitment of both parties to adhere to the documented responsibilities.

Key Features of the Iowa Residential Lease Agreement

The Iowa Residential Lease Agreement encompasses several key features that are crucial for effective rental management. Essential terms included in the lease comprise rental amounts, security deposits, utility responsibilities, and notification requirements. These elements are vital for maintaining transparency and accountability within the landlord-tenant relationship.
Furthermore, the document allows for customizable fields such as names, dates, and addresses. Landlords and tenants are encouraged to clearly specify payment methods and responsibilities to prevent misunderstandings in the future.

Digital Signature vs. Wet Signature Requirements

Understanding the signature options available is imperative for effectively executing the Iowa Residential Lease Agreement. Digital signatures hold legal standing in Iowa, allowing for a secure and convenient signing process. With pdfFiller, users can easily eSign documents, promoting efficiency in handling leases.
However, certain situations may necessitate a wet signature. It's important to be aware of these instances to ensure compliance with all legal requirements.
